首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

提取集群成员(pheatmap)

提取集群成员(pheatmap)是一个用于在R语言中进行热图绘制和聚类分析的函数。它可以帮助用户可视化高维数据集中的模式和关系。

热图是一种通过颜色编码来展示数据矩阵的可视化方式。在热图中,每个数据点都用一个颜色来表示其数值大小,从而使得用户能够直观地观察到数据的模式和趋势。

pheatmap函数的主要参数包括数据矩阵、聚类方法、颜色映射、行列标签等。用户可以根据自己的需求调整这些参数,以获得最佳的可视化效果。

pheatmap函数的优势在于其简单易用和灵活性。它提供了丰富的参数选项,使用户能够自定义热图的外观和布局。此外,pheatmap还支持多种聚类方法,包括层次聚类和K均值聚类,以帮助用户发现数据中的群组结构。

pheatmap函数在生物信息学、基因表达分析、药物研发等领域有广泛的应用。例如,在基因表达分析中,研究人员可以使用pheatmap函数将基因表达数据可视化为热图,以便观察基因的表达模式和样本之间的相似性。

对于腾讯云用户,腾讯云提供了一系列与云计算相关的产品和服务,可以帮助用户进行数据处理和分析。其中,腾讯云的云服务器、云数据库、云存储等产品可以为用户提供稳定可靠的基础设施支持。此外,腾讯云还提供了人工智能、大数据分析等高级服务,以满足用户在云计算领域的需求。

更多关于腾讯云产品的信息,您可以访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

QQ群成员怎么提取? 1分钟提取一个群的成员信息

大家在做QQ营销推广的时候,经常需要把别人QQ群的成员信息导出来,自己在用来营销推广。怎么才能快速的把别人的QQ群成员信息提取出来呢?今天古圣教大家一个方法,最快1分钟可以提取1个群的成员信息。...图片我们可以打开QQ群的官网,进入登录自己的QQ号码,然后选择需要提取成员信息的群,就可以看到所有的群成员信息列表。...然后我们可以用过在线正则表达式,通过正则把这些群成员的QQ号都提取出来,但是这个方法要懂正则才可以,不然也是很麻烦的。...当然除了这个方法,我们把这个技术也开发成了一款工具,通过工具可以快速的提取出Q群的成员。图片用软件可以筛选导出的条件,例如昵称、Q龄、性别、加群时间、最后发言都可以筛选的。...以上就是古圣给大家分享的提取Q群成员的技术。

3.1K10

Raft算法之集群成员变化篇

一、集群成员变化可能带来的问题 集群成员变化是一个常见操作,主要是增加、删除节点,主要的场景有升级、服务器老化等,当然如果我们对服务的SLA没太大要求,直接关闭集群是最简单的办法。...直接将集群成员配置从旧配置切到新配置会有脑裂问题,举个例子: ?...所以这2台机器启动的时候认为集群中有5个节点; 2、然后修改Server3的配置,改成5节点; 这时发生选举,即上图中红色箭头所指的位置,这时候每个节点看到的集群成员如下,为了方便描述,统一将Server...二、变更方案 官方给的方案是二阶段变更: 集群先从旧成员配置Cold切换到一个过渡成员配置,称为共同一致(joint consensus),共同一致是旧成员配置Cold和新成员配置Cnew的组合Cold...2、移除不在 Cnew 中的服务器可能会扰乱集群 主要是移除的情况,设想一个集群有5个节点:1,2,3,4,当前Leader是2,现在要把1移除掉,假如2已经将新的成员配置:2,3,4已经同 步给3和4

1K41
  • 【C++类和对象】const成员函数及流插入提取

    目录 前言 1.const成员函数 2.取地址以及const取地址操作符重载 3.流插入流提取运算符重载 4.结语 1.const成员函数 const成员函数是指在函数声明和定义时使用const关键字修饰的成员函数...3.流插入流提取运算符重载 在C++中,可以通过重载流插入流提取运算符(>)来自定义输入输出操作。 流插入运算符(>)用于从输入流中提取数据。它的重载函数应该以 istream&类型作为返回值,并以一个 istream&类型的参数(通常是输入流对象)和要提取到的数据的引用作为参数。...在C++中流插入提取操作符重载是不可以重载成成员函数,因为它们参数的顺序不可以改变,例如: 这是因为流插入第一个运算符是cout,而如果将其重载为成员函数第一个参数就是类和对象中隐含的this指针...,所以参数顺序不匹配,我们只能将其重载成全局函数;与此同时流插入运算符和流提取运算符通常都是以友元函数的形式定义在类的声明内部,这允许它们访问类的私有成员

    12010

    通过集群成员变更来看 etcd 的分布式一致性

    集群成员变更一直是 etcd 最棘手的问题之一,在变更过程中会遇到各种各样的挑战,我们稍后一一来看。为了把问题描述清楚,首先需要了解 etcd 内部的 raft 实现。...所以新加入的节点很容易对集群造成影响,无论是 leader 选举还是将后续的更新传播给新成员,都很容易导致集群不可用。 ? 网络隔离 如果发生了网络隔离,集群还会正常工作吗?...一旦集群无法满足 quorum,就再也无法完成集群成员变更。 ? 多节点集群类似。例如一个拥有 3 个节点的集群,新加入一个配置错误的节点后,quorum 大小从 2 变为 3。...相对于其他方面来说,leader 选举对 etcd 集群的可用性有着至关重要的影响:有没有办法在集群成员变更的时候不改变集群的 quorum 大小?...或者有没有更安全的办法来完成集群成员变更的操作(新加入节点配置错误不会导致集群的容错能力下降)?集群管理员新加入节点时需要关心网络协议吗?

    2.7K23

    拟时序分析的热图提取基因问题

    当然具体参数理解需要自行发力哦,见:使用monocle做拟时序分析(单细胞谱系发育) 用法只是最基础的知识而已,更多的时候,我们需要活学活用,比如课程学员提到的问题,就是因为做不到活学活用,他想知道下面的拟时序分析的热图提取基因...rows. hclust_method = "ward.D2" return_heatmap Whether to return the pheatmap object to the user...很明显,这个函数其实就是pheatmap的一个包装罢了,本质上也是调用 hclust 而已,使用的是ward.D2距离。...实际上学员提问是有问题的 因为学员之间丢出这个热图,然后咨询如何在图片里面提取基因名字,所以大家只能是问是pdf还是png的图片呢?是不是可以AI或者PS解析它,拿到基因名字呢?...如果学员是直接问:使用monocle的plot_pseudotime_heatmap函数绘制的热图里面的基因聚集成为3类,该如何提取基因名字,其实就很简单了。

    2.7K30

    可能只是一个函数,却要耗费你大半天

    为了一件小事,耽搁了大半天功夫 ——你的努力不会白费 好像不少人问过我一个聚类后的树如何根据肉眼观察到的cluster情况来提前指定的树的子集,有点类似于WGCNA分析把几千个基因划分成若干个module后能提取各个...如果想提取中间的一个子集,不知道有cutree函数的就会纠结半天,但是知道的,就下面几句话而已。...最后,所有的错误,都可以通过调试来找到的,希望你们多折腾http://www.biotrainee.com/thread-778-1-1.html 其他优秀跟帖 用pheatmap画图热图的时候不需要前面加...png或pdf这类的函数创建画板,在pheatmap里面本身就有了,只需要直接在pheatmap里面定义出图的格式就能直接有了。

    49231
    领券